### Key Ceremony Checklist — Item 7: ParcelPing Webhook Signer

Rotate the ParcelPing parcel-tracking webhook signing key. Two custodians present. Verify HSM serial against the Quorale ledger. Generate, export public half, update the webhook config, fire one test delivery, confirm signature validates. Shred the old key slot. Then seal the recovery kit: the kit unlocks with the passphrase recorded below.

strongbox words: caswyn-druwyn

## Larkmill Render Service — Environments

We vendor all third-party fonts into the repo rather than fetching them at build time, so every environment renders identically regardless of upstream availability. Reviewers should confirm that any font change updates the checksum manifest and the license notes together. For reference when reviewing diffs, the environment-specific configuration currently in effect is shown below.

settings of kajef-hafog:
[ralys]
team = holiel
access_code = ac_fa834c
owner = noviel.gilion
host = ralys.halixlabs.test
port = 9300
peer = raldor.ordindata.local
salt = e78ca807
pin = 4961

Finance Review Summary — Sales Leads, Mardell & Frey
The quarterly cash-flow forecast shows stable inflows, supported by strong renewals in the Caldon territory. Outflows rise modestly due to the Westrow showroom fit-out. Commission payments remain on schedule. No changes to credit terms this quarter. The confidential note on business plans is set out below.

internal memo for bahap-yagug: Headcount on the Ulaix team goes from 3 to 100 by the end of January. Gross margin on Ulaix came in at 10 percent against a plan of 15 percent.